Handover: the stale-cache bug in Lattermill's quote service is resolved. Root cause was the invalidation worker skipping keys with trailing whitespace. Fix deployed Tuesday; postmortem doc is in the Ironvale wiki under incidents. Support should watch for any lingering reports of outdated pricing through Friday. If you need to flush the cache cluster manually, the admin console requires the recovery passphrase, which is:

unlock words, hahip-baduf: holwyn-istath-julvan

Welcome to the Lumenreport support rotation. When customers ask why rows with equal values appear in different orders between runs, explain that the builder uses a stable merge sort, so ties preserve insertion order. Unstable ordering almost always means a stale cache, which you can clear via the admin panel after authenticating. The admin panel requires the signing secret, set in the env file on the line below.

env line for fafof-fahag: LEDGER_TOKEN5=f8790

Subject: SQL lint cut-over done

Team,

The switch to the Querykeep linter finished last night. All repos now lint SQL files on commit; the old checker is retired. Expect tickets about newly flagged legacy files — point folks to the suppression comment syntax, not exemptions. Rules are stricter on naming and explicit joins. Active rule settings are below.

deployment values, bawef-bagep:
ULAIX_PIN=3809
ULAIX_METRICS_HOST=metrics.ulaix.zemvarlabs.internal
ULAIX_LOG_LEVEL=error
ULAIX_TENANT=novael

**Mgmt Meeting Minutes — Retiring the Brightline Range**

Quick recap for sales leads at Fenholt Supplies: we agreed to retire the Brightline fixture range by year-end. Remaining stock moves to clearance pricing next month, and accounts on standing orders get migrated to the Lumetta range. Trade-in incentives were approved in principle. The confidential note on next steps sits just below.

board note of bajof-bajeg: The pricing group signed off on a budget of $13.4 million for Project Sildor. The renewal with Lamixek Holdings closes at $48.9 million a year, 49 percent above the last contract.